2. Protecting the Learner Permit
Equipped with a passing theory test certificate, candidates can look for their Learner Permit. In Ireland, a learner permit is released for various classifications of vehicles, but the basic category for a car is Category B.

3. Important Driver Training (EDT)
For anybody looking for their very first Category B student authorization on or after April 4, 2011, finishing the Essential Driver Training (EDT) course is obligatory. EDT is a training program including 12 one-hour lessons created to teach basic driving abilities and improve roadway safety awareness.

4. The Driving Test (Practical Exam)
Once the EDT logbook is completed, the student must wait a necessary statutory period (generally six months from the date of the student license issuance) before they are eligible to book the useful driving test by means of the Road Safety Authority (RSA).
What to Expect on Test Day:
The practical driving test lasts roughly 40 minutes and evaluates numerous proficiencies.
Test ComponentWhat the Tester AssessesVehicle Safety ChecksUnderstanding of under-the-bonnet parts and secondary car controls (lights, wipers, demisters).Technical QuestionsOral questioning concerning the Rules of the Road (hand signals, roadway signs).General DrivingAbility to drive securely and legally in numerous traffic conditions, city locations, and junctions.ManoeuvresExecution of a reverse around a corner, a turnabout (three-point turn), and hill starts.Common Reasons for Failing:

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Can I drive on freeways with a learner allow?
No. Student permit holders are legally forbidden from driving on Irish freeways. Motorway driving can only start once you have passed your dry run and acquired your full driving license.

Can I use an automated cars and truck for my driving test?
Yes, you can. Nevertheless, if you pass your test in an automated lorry, your full driving license will restrict you to Driving License Ie automated automobiles just. To drive a manual vehicle, you need to take the test in a manual automobile.
What takes place if my driving license is lost or taken?
You can quickly obtain a replacement license online or in person through the NDLS by supplying proper identification, completing the application, and paying a replacement cost.
